I looked on the pattern forum and didint find a lot. I just got a M2 (like a whole bunch of guys did for that price) and Im looking for a choke shell combination to start with. Im not looking for something that is super tight because most of my shots are at 30 yards or less in the woods.
If your shooting 30yds or less then pretty much any of them will be fine with magblend or longbeards. Hell the factory one should be fine at that distance. A more open option would be a pure gold 670 but in reality I wouldn't waste a bunch of money testing them for 30 and under

My M2 performed best with the combination of a Primos Jellyhead .660 and Nitro brand shells with shot size #6 and #7. I tried factory and Indian Creek chokes with all types of shells. This combination was best for my gun, but each gun is a little different.

The combination of a Sumtoy .650 and Hevi #7s or #6s is hard to beat out of my SBE II, which is also a Crio barrel like the M2.

Well I went looking for a Primos Jelly head but couldnt find one local. Ended up with a Indian Creek .660. I shot Winchester #4,#5,#6,AND #7.5. aT 40 yards they all produced a killing pattern but the 6 and 7.5 patterned the best .
